2025 Ozarks Tour 鈥 Hot Springs and Eureka Springs, Ark. And Branson, Mo.
A five-day, four-night trip May 12-16 will take visitors first to the Diamond Lakes region Hot Springs, Ark., including a trolley tour of Hot Springs and Bathhouse Row. They will then move on to Branson, Mo., for two nights with an itinerary that will include attending performances featuring the Haygoods, Hot Rods and High Heels, the Uptown Caf茅 and 鈥淒AVID,鈥 at the Sights and Sound Theatre. The group will then travel to Eureka Springs for a tram tour of the Victorian community and an overnight stay in North Little Rock before departing the next day to return home.
Sites on the itinerary during the trip include the Garvan Woodland Gardens, Top of the Rock, Lost Canyon Cave, Ancient Ozarks History Museum and the historic Crescent Hotel.

Opry鈥檚 100th Birthday 鈥 Nashville, Tenn.
A three-day, two-night trip to Nashville, Tenn., will celebrate the 100th birthday of the Grand Ole Opry. Visitors will stay at the Gaylord Opryland Hotel July 14-16 and enjoy a Lyrical Legends Songwriter Performance and Dinner, main floor seats at a Grand Ole Opry performance with a backstage tour, an exclusive dinner party with a special appearance by an Opry artist and more.

2025 Holiday Tour 鈥 Pigeon Forge, Tenn. and Asheville, N.C.
The Alumni Association will be traveling to Pigeon Forge, Tenn., and Asheville, N.C. Dec. 2-5 for a holiday tour that offers multiple entertainment options and a candlelight tour of the historic Biltmore House.
The tour will begin in Pigeon Forge where the group will enjoy performances at the Country Tonite Theatre, a 鈥淩emembering Red鈥 Skelton tribute show and the ARRAY Variety Show and meals at Carino鈥檚 Italian Grill, Applewood Farmhouse Restaurant and Puckett鈥檚 Restaurant.
In Asheville, the group will enjoy lunch at Grove Park Inn before exploring the hotel and taking in the National Gingerbread House contest displays. That evening, they will have dinner at the Biltmore Estate before taking an audio-guided Candlelight tour of the Biltmore House.
